Publisher's Summary

When Charlie Flint is sent a mysterious package of cuttings about a brutal murder, it instantly grabs her attention. The murder occurred in the grounds of her old Oxford college - a groom battered to death just hours after his wedding. As his bride and wedding guests sipped champagne, his alleged killers were slipping his bloodstained body into the river.

Charlie doesn't know who sent the package, or why, yet she can't get the crime out of her head. But as she delves deeper, and steps back into the mysterious world of Oxford colleges, she realises that there is much more to this crime than meets the eye.

Tedious

Persevered till the end, but it worked as a sleeping pill rather than entertainment.

Given the number of characters and rather unappealing ‘lust interest’, the ‘perp’ was easily apparent - though frankly motivation and in some cases execution all a bit far fetched.

The narration within a narration simply irritated and meant all characters remained undeveloped.

Narrators fine. But not Val Mcdermid’s best.
